什么是底层节点?
底层节点是指在区块链网络中,负责维护区块链数据、存储交易信息及其验证过程的主要节点。它们是区块链结构的基础,确保信息的安全与完整。每一个底层节点都保存着区块链的完整副本,并负责处理所有用户的交易请求。由于底层节点的重要性,网络中的大多数功能和操作都依赖于它们。一旦有新交易或区块生成,底层节点会通过共识机制进行验证,并在网络上传播。
底层节点的功能是什么?

底层节点的功能主要包括以下几个方面:
- 数据存储与维护:底层节点保存着完整的区块链数据,为所有网络参与者提供可靠的信息源。
- 交易验证:底层节点负责验证所有交易的有效性,确保每个交易都符合区块链的协议。
- 网络共识:底层节点参与共识机制,确保全网的交易数据一致,从而防止双重支付等问题。
- 节点间通讯:底层节点与其他节点进行通信,更新和传播交易记录与区块信息。
底层节点在区块链中的作用
底层节点在区块链网络中承担着核心的角色,这是因为它们直接影响着整个网络的安全性与稳定性。它们负责维护网络的去中心化特性,参与共识机制,交易的有效性与完整性由这些节点进行验证。底层节点能够通过独立存储和验证交易,避免信息集中化带来的风险。
如何判断一个节点是否是底层节点?

通常,底层节点具备以下特征:
- 数据完整性:底层节点保存整个区块链的完整链条,能够对历史交易进行追溯。
- 网络参与能力:底层节点能够主动参与共识机制,而不仅仅是被动接受更新。
- 资源投入:底层节点需要较高的计算和存储资源,具备持续在线的能力。
通过这些特征可以明确区分底层节点与其他类型的节点,如轻节点或代理节点。
底层节点和轻节点的区别
底层节点与轻节点之间有着根本的区别。底层节点可以完成区块的完整验证,而轻节点则仅下载必要的信息,通常通过底层节点来请求完整的交易记录。轻节点因其较低的资源要求适合那些设备性能受限的用户,但在交易的安全性和完整性验证上依赖于底层节点的支持。
底层节点对区块链发展的影响
底层节点的存在确保了区块链的去中心化及其安全性。随着技术的演进,底层节点的发展趋势也影响了区块链的可扩展性、性能及应用场景。底层节点的数量与分布直接影响着网络的安全性及稳定性,如何底层节点的功能与管理,是未来区块链技术发展的重要课题。
相关问题及详细介绍
1. 底层节点如何保证区块链的安全性?
底层节点通过验证交易的有效性、参与共识机制保证数据的一致性,进而确保区块链的安全性。通过采取加密、分布式存储等技术,底层节点形成一种抵抗外部攻击的能力。在应用层面,底层节点的角色至关重要,任何交易的生成与确认都必须经过其验证,降低了欺诈和恶意操作的风险。
2. 如何构建一个高效的底层节点网络?
构建一个高效的底层节点网络涉及高效的资源管理、节点间的相互信任机制以及合理的激励制度等。为了提升网络的性能,应关注节点数量、带宽、存储能效、计算能力等因素。此外,通过实现P2P网络架构,数据传输,有助于减少延迟,提升整个系统的响应速度。
3. 底层节点在区块链应用中的重要性?
底层节点在区块链应用中的重要性体现在保障系统的透明性、可追溯性、无可篡改性等方面。无论是金融、供应链还是物联网,底层节点都为其提供了可信的基础设施,确保数据的安全、有效和透明。
4. 底层节点的运行成本?
底层节点的运行成本主要包括硬件购买成本、网络带宽费用、维护费用等。底层节点需要持续在线,保证及时响应网络请求,这意味着需要持续支付服务器费用。此外,随着区块链的不断发展,底层节点的运营成本必然会随着交易量的增加而变化,应合理预算并评估成本。
5. 如何选择合适的底层节点策略?
选择合适的底层节点策略涉及技术选型、硬件配置及网络架构设计。首先需根据区块链网络的规模、性能需求、用户负载等来确定节点数量及其地理分布。其次,采用高性能的存储器和网络接入策略,确保底层节点能够快速处理和响应请求,提高用户体验。
6. 未来底层节点发展的趋势是什么?
未来底层节点的发展将朝向更高效、更智能的方向。通过云计算和边缘计算的结合,底层节点能够配备更强大的计算能力,同时在环保和资源利用上有所改善。此外,AI和大数据等新技术的应用,将进一步提升底层节点的智能化水平,为区块链网络的自我与管理提供支持。
整体内容总字数:约3600字。